When it comes to store-bought lemonade, there are several ways to elevate its taste and make it even more refreshing. Here are some tips to make your store-bought lemonade taste better:

1. Add In Some Herbs:
One of the easiest ways to enhance the flavor of your lemonade is by adding herbs. Herbs like mint, lavender, and basil can bring a delightful floral note to your drink. Their natural sweetness complements the tangy lemonade, creating a harmonious blend. Simply muddle a few leaves of your chosen herb in your glass before pouring in the lemonade, or infuse the herbs in a simple syrup to add to your drink.

2. Experiment with Fruit Infusions:
Another way to enhance the taste of store-bought lemonade is by infusing it with fruits. Consider adding slices of fresh strawberries, blueberries, or even peaches to your glass. These fruits will release their natural juices into the lemonade, adding a burst of flavor and a touch of sweetness. You can also freeze some fruit slices and use them as ice cubes for a refreshing twist.

3. Create a Zesty Citrus Blend:
If you find that the store-bought lemonade lacks a bit of tanginess, you can always enhance it with freshly squeezed citrus juices. Add a splash of lime or orange to your lemonade to give it a zesty kick. This not only brightens the flavor but also adds complexity to the overall taste profile. Just be sure to balance the proportions to avoid overpowering the lemonade.

4. Sweeten Naturally:
If you prefer a sweeter lemonade, try using natural sweeteners instead of processed sugars. Agave nectar, honey, or maple syrup can all add a touch of sweetness without overwhelming the citrus flavors. Start with a small amount and adjust to your preference, keeping in mind that natural sweeteners tend to have a more subtle impact compared to granulated sugar.

5. Chill with Flavorful Ice Cubes:
Instead of using regular ice cubes, consider making flavored ice cubes to add an extra layer of taste to your lemonade. Freeze small pieces of fruit, such as raspberries, blackberries, or even lemon slices, in your ice cube tray. As the ice cubes melt, they will release their flavors into the lemonade, enhancing the overall taste experience.
